Loving Zenutrients' Gugo Shampoo

I never had hair problems - EVER.  I was always so proud that my hair was jet black, silky and full.  Would you believe that I've never had a single strand of white hair?  Yes, I was also very proud of that because we have a family history of having white hair early.  I was, you can say - happy with the crown of hair on my head.  I've tried long and short hair styles too!  I've colored it and styled it, used products everyday - but I never had it re-bonded.  I was too chicken to damage my hair.  That was my only limitation when it comes to my hair.  I had this No to re-bonding policy even if I was tempted sooooo many many many times.  Hahaha!!

But that fact (of having no hair problems) is long forgotten now.  Ever since becoming a mom, well - you can say - I suffered major hair loss.  When I was breastfeeding Kailee - it seemed that I was having quite heavy of a hair fall/loss.  I never noticed it until a friend of mine mentioned it.  I felt really embarrassed because - my hairline was receding and I am female.  At first, I refused to accept it.  I looked at pictures from weeks prior and months prior just to compare.  And I couldn't believe it.  I would stare at myself in the mirror inspecting my front hairline.  I am not a vain person, but I did this everyday, I was half expecting my hair to grow back soon.  I was very affected by the hair loss.  I didn't even want to go out with friends.  Then one day, I realized - you know what, just accept the hair loss.  It will eventually grow back anyway.

And it did.  Very awkwardly at that.  I tell you when you saw me then, my front hair looked really funny.  My hair is kind of wavy - so you can just imagine the mound of hair that I had in the front part - it was *wavy*.  Hahaha!!  I tried hair spray, and brushed it back - but it only emphasized the receging hairline.  I tried hairbands, headbands - but they weren't *bagay* to my face shape.  It took months to be honest, a LOT of awkward months - but my hair eventually grew back.  But this time - it grew back with strands of white hair.  

I would pull out the white hair and keep them.  I guess, I wanted to keep count.  But when I started to find white strands every so often - I stopped and threw them all away.  It was such an eye opener for me, it made me realize that I was age-ing.  So I decided to just color my hair - because the strands of white hair was depressing me.  

With colored hair - shampooing is not easy.  My hair has somehow dried out (because of age) and it has become very stiff after I shower.  I then became lazy in drying my hair too, so I would just air dry it.  I am thankful that I found a conditioner to use that would somehow tame my hair.  And I was contended.  

I've heard and seen Zenutrients' Gugo shampoo for years now.  I have friends who swear by it, they have repeatedly told me to try it.  But matigas ang ulo ko e, and I didn't listen.  I have this certain impression of a gugo shampoo being pungent.  People swear by it's effectivity but I just couldn't bring myself to buy and use it.  Once, someone gave me a full bottle of Gugo shampoo, and I just gave it away.  I don't know - I just can't bring myself to use it.



Last week, while we were in Greenhills we stopped by the toy store across of Zenutirents in Virra Mall.  For some strange reason, I picked up a bottle and saw that there was actual Gugo inside the shampoo bottle!  It was very surprising to see it to be honest.  But what surprised me more was when I declared to the staff that I was buying the smallest size to try!  Hahaha!  It costs P200 something, I forgot the exact amount.  To be honest, it was quite pricey since a big bottle of my favorite shampoos would cost the same and the size was triple of it.  But I bought it anyway. 

I tried it when I got home.  I loved the minty smell and I loved the minty feel it had on my scalp.  One thing I didn't like though was that after washing the shampoo off my hair - it became stiff!  I then used my trusty conditioner and it became softer again.

I was surprised that when I brushed my wet hair it was smooth!  I used to dread brushing because of the tangles and the stiffness of the hair.  I then used my hair dryer to dry it and I was surprised how FLAT & SMOOTH my hair was becoming.  After drying it - I felt it.  MY HEAD FELT LIGHTER!!  Hahaha.. I had the same feeling when I cut my hair last November.  IT WAS LIBERATING!  I loved that my hair was light, smooth and not heavy to my head.  I thought, ah - baka this was just a fluke.  I declared to use it everyday since using it first last Sunday.

4 nights have passed and I'm officially a believer.  What made me a believe?  Well, on Monday night, I was too lazy to use the hair dryer - so I just left my hair to dry by itself.  I just brushed it once after towel drying it and that was it.  I was very surprised that when I woke up - my hair felt light, it was smoother (like I hair dry-ed it the night before) and it was very manageable - no tangles!!  I loved the result, but the at the back of my head - maybe it was a fluke (I thought, I was still doubting it) - so I did the same thing for the next two nights.  

The result was still the same.  Hair felt lighter, no more tangles, hair was soft to the touch and smoother.  I was AMAZED with the result.  I guess it was only then that I realized why my friends loved this shampoo.  This was the reason.  I wish I listened to them sooner.  Sigh.

I guess, I needed to go through the process on my own to believe in the effect of Zenurtrients' Gugo Shampoo.  I am now officially a convert.  I will go buy the large pump shampoo when I got to the mall this weekend.  Hahaha!  I will purchase a small one for my mom to try too.  I still have an issue with the price, but then when I think about it - it makes my hair feel great thus making me feel good.  And when I feel good about myself - I am a happier person and happiness is infectious!  Hahaha... I guess, it will be worth it.
